CAJUN-STYLE FRENCH BREAD RECIPE | MYRECIPES



Cajun-Style French Bread Recipe | MyRecipes image

Serve this bold and rich bread as an appetizer. It also pairs well with vinaigrette-dressed salad or your favorite grilled meat.

Provided by Wendi Allen, Brandon, Mississippi

Total Time 45 minutes

Prep Time 20 minutes

Yield Makes 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 (14-oz.) French bread loaf
¼ cup butter, melted
1 medium onion, finely chopped
1 small jalapeño pepper, seeded and finely minced
1 garlic clove, minced
? cup mayonnaise
½ cup (2 oz.) shredded Parmesan cheese
1 tablespoon lemon juice
½ te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
1?½ teaspoons Creole seasoning

Steps:

  • Cut bread loaf in half lengthwise. Brush melted butter evenly onto cut sides of bread halves.
  • Stir together onion, jalapeño pepper, and next 5 ingredients, and spread mixture evenly over buttered sides of bread halves. Place bread halves, buttered sides up, on a baking sheet, and sprinkle evenly with 1 1/2 tsp. Creole seasoning.
  • Bake at 350° for 18 to 20 minutes or until brown and bubbly. Let stand 5 minutes; cut crosswise into 1-inch-thick slices, and serve immediately.
  • Note: To make ahead, wrap prepared unbaked bread halves in aluminum foil, place in a large zip-top plastic freezer bag, and freeze up to 1 month. To bake frozen, remove bread halves from freezer bag, and place foil-wrapped bread on a baking sheet. Bake at 350° for 10 minutes or until thawed. Remove foil, return to baking sheet, buttered sides up, and bake 8 to 10 minutes or until brown and bubbly. Let stand 5 minutes, and cut bread halves as directed.

CRUSTY FRENCH LOAF RECIPE: HOW TO MAKE IT



Crusty French Loaf Recipe: How to Make It image

A delicate texture makes this French bread absolutely wonderful. I sometimes use this French bread recipe to make breadsticks, which I brush with melted butter and sprinkle with garlic powder. —Deanna Naivar, Temple, Texas

Provided by Taste of Home

Total Time 45 minutes

Prep Time 20 minutes

Cook Time 25 minutes

Yield 1 loaf (16 pieces).

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 package (1/4 ounce) active dry yeast
1 cup warm water (110° to 115°)
2 tablespoons sugar
2 tablespoons canola oil
1-1/2 teaspoons salt
3 to 3-1/4 cups all-purpose flour
Cornmeal
1 large egg white
1 teaspoon cold water

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, dissolve yeast in warm water. Add sugar, oil, salt and 2 cups flour. Beat until blended. Stir in enough remaining flour to form a stiff dough., Turn onto a floured surface; knead until smooth and elastic, 6-8 minutes. Place in a greased bowl, turning once to grease top. Cover and let rise in a warm place until doubled, about 1 hour. Punch dough down; return to bowl. Cover and let rise for 30 minutes. , Preheat oven to 375°. Punch dough down. Turn onto a lightly floured surface. Shape into a 16x2-1/2-in. loaf with tapered ends. Sprinkle cornmeal over a greased baking sheet; place loaf on baking sheet. Cover and let rise until doubled, about 25 minutes. , Beat egg white and cold water; brush over dough. With a sharp knife, make diagonal slashes 2 in. apart across top of loaf. Bake until golden brown, 25-30 minutes. Remove from pan to a wire rack to cool.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 109 calories, FatContent 2g fat (0 saturated fat), CholesterolContent 0 cholesterol, SodiumContent 225mg sodium, CarbohydrateContent 20g carbohydrate (2g sugars, FiberContent 1g fiber), ProteinContent 3g protein.

Aug 24, 1998 · One remark: French bread requires a water wash and baking with steam to come out crunchy, eggs are a no-no on this type of bread. To get the steam, simply put an oven safe container on the bottom shelf of the oven and use a water spray pump to mist water over the loaves twice while it's baking, instead of the egg wash the recipe mentions.

WHAT IS FRENCH BREAD? (WITH PICTURES) - DELIGHTED COOKING
French bread is bread made from white wheat flour that has a strong and chewy crust. The interior is full of bubbles, often due to the use of sourdough starters to prepare the bread, though not all French bread is sourdough. Usually, the loaf is shaped into a torpedo, batard, or baguette style. In France, the baguette form is standard, and ...

BAKE BETTER BREAD: FRENCH FLOUR - SEVERN BITES
Mar 27, 2019 · French Flour Types. When baking bread using French flour, you’ll need to know what type to use. Each bag of French flour is labelled with a number. It’s important to understand these numbers. Typically, French flour for breadmaking is Type 55 or T55. The higher the number, the more of the whole grain it contains.
